Ford Pitches Flex Via 'Band From TV' Deal
Jun 18, 2008, 5:00 AM
The partnership is with "Band From TV" an L.A. band whose personnel are also cast members on shows like "Alias," "Desperate Housewives" and "The Bachelor." The Ford Flex Rally is a scavenger hunt in which 10 celebrity teams drive the 2009 Ford Flex around looking for clues.
The event, starting Saturday, will be hosted by "Band From TV" formed by "Alias" actor Greg Grunberg and peopled by the likes of Hugh Laurie ("House"), Teri Hatcher ("Desperate Housewives") and Jesse Spencer ("House").
Following the Flex Rally, the "Band From TV" will perform at an exclusive red-carpet event at the finish line that will also feature a performance from Santogold, who also appears on new ads for the Flex vehicle.
